Drive-in tent-only campsite The Sunnyhill Restoration Area features a primitive tent-only campsite, picnic areas, boat launches and an observation platform. The reservation-only campsite is located in a mature hardwood hammock approximately 0.8 mile from the Oak Cove Trailhead parking area on 182nd Avenue Road, Ocklawaha. This campsite is equipped with a fire ring, picnic table, benches, pavilion and pitcher pump. There are no restroom facilities. Reservations are required at least 48 hours ahead and may be made up to 90 days in advance. Vehicle make, model and license plate number of all vehicles accessing the campsite are required when making a reservation. A valid vehicle pass allows vehicle access to and from the reservable campsite only. Visitors may not drive anywhere else on the property for any reason. Recreational vehicles (RVs), campers, ATVs, UTVs and dirt bikes are prohibited on all District lands. In addition to primitive tent camping, other recreational opportunities at Sunnyhill include hiking, horseback riding, bicycling, wildlife viewing and picnicking. Bank fishing is allowed on the canal at the western edge of the property. Visitors may enjoy hiking or bicycling along 20 miles of trails throughout the two tracts that make up this property. Check-in: No earlier than 1 p.m. Check-out: No later than 11 a.m. Maximum length of stay: 7 consecutive days Maximum occupancy: 24 Maximum number of vehicles allowed: 4 (all must be listed on vehicle permit and include makes, models, colors and license plate numbers)
